Prague welcomes young scientists to the international conference BioPhys Spring 2025

Until April 20, 2025, those interested in participating in the international BioPhys Spring conference for PhD students and young scientists, which the Czech University of Life Sciences in Prague will host on May 29 and 30, both days from 9:00 am. The Czech University of Life Sciences organizes this meeting together with the Institute of Agrophysics of the Polish Academy of Sciences in Lublin, the Slovak University of Agriculture in Nitra, the Hungarian University of Agriculture and Natural Sciences MATE, and the National Institute of Technology in Bandung (Indonesia).

 

This year's 24th edition takes place under the auspices of the Minister of the Environment Petr Hladik and the Rector of VZU Petr Sklenička and, with the financial contribution of the Polish Government. "As these conferences focus on natural sciences, agriculture, biotechnology, renewable resources, and environmental protection, they are always a great opportunity for our PhD students and young scientists to exchange experiences, present their first results, and establish international contacts," notes Petr Sklenička, Rector of the Czech Agricultural University.

 

According to Martin Libra from the CZU, who chairs the BioPhys Spring 2025 conference, these meetings are a unique platform for deepening cooperation between partner institutions. And how does Professor Libra evaluate this quarter-century-long cooperation between universities and research institutes in the Central European region?

"Professor Blahovec founded the conference, and initially, several editions took place at the Faculty of Engineering in Prague. Then, we started to rotate with our foreign partners in the organization of the conference, and the conference gradually gained importance. Today, it is a major international event, and its targeting of PhD students and young scientists gives it a certain uniqueness," emphasizes the chairman of the Biophys Spring conference, Professor Martin Libra.

What is required for a PhD student to attend the conference?

You must register by April 20, 2025, at For participants – BIOPHYS 2025 and upload a two-page abstract there, folded according to the prescribed template, which is also available for download on the conference website. The length of the oral presentation at the conference is five minutes for the actual presentation and a further five minutes for discussion. A book of extended abstracts will be published. The template and registration information are on the conference website. Participation is free of charge.
